ColorDialog::Color Property
.NET Framework (current version)
Gets or sets the color selected by the user.
Assembly: System.Windows.Forms (in System.Windows.Forms.dll)
Property Value
Type: System.Drawing::ColorThe color selected by the user. If a color is not selected, the default value is black.
The following example illustrates the creation of new ColorDialog. This example requires that the method is called from within an existing form that has a TextBox and Button placed on it.
private: void button1_Click( Object^ /*sender*/, System::EventArgs^ /*e*/ ) { ColorDialog^ MyDialog = gcnew ColorDialog; // Keeps the user from selecting a custom color. MyDialog->AllowFullOpen = false; // Allows the user to get help. (The default is false.) MyDialog->ShowHelp = true; // Sets the initial color select to the current text color. MyDialog->Color = textBox1->ForeColor; // Update the text box color if the user clicks OK if ( MyDialog->ShowDialog() == ::System::Windows::Forms::DialogResult::OK ) { textBox1->ForeColor = MyDialog->Color; } }
